Tender description

The Council is inviting tenders from potential suppliers who may be interested in delivering a Housing Related Support Service for Young People aged 16-25. There are 2 contracts: Woodleaze, a new supported housing scheme in Yate, South Gloucestershire for up to 18 young people with higher support needs, half of which will be care leavers whose needs couldn't previously be met within current supported housing provision. Southwold House and Andrew Millman Court is a supported housing scheme for up to 22 young people in Yate, South Gloucestershire. Reference number DN 416749. Lot 1: Woodleaze, a new supported housing scheme in Yate, South Gloucestershire for up to 18 young people with higher support needs, half of which will be care leavers whose needs couldn't previously be met within current supported housing provision. The Council wants to minimise homelessness and maximise the chances for young people to enable them to transition effectively into adulthood, and to develop independence. The duration of the contract is 5 years, with the potential to extend for a further 2 years, making a total contract term of 7. Any contract extensions or renewals will be dependent upon continued need for the services, satisfactory performance and availability of funding. The anticipated contract start date for Woodleaze is 3.5.2020, however this is subject to change due to the conversion of the building. A definite commencement date will be agreed with the successful provider. South Gloucestershire Council is a Unitary Authority in the South West of England.
